Persicaria amplexicaulis
Persicaria 'Lisan' is an indispensable perennial for anyone who wants to have a blooming garden even in the second half of summer and in autumn. This type of persicaria has its origins in the mountainous regions of the Himalayas, where it naturally inhabits moister meadows and forest edges. As a result, the plant is very hardy and vigorous even in the garden, loves nutritious, humous soils that retain moisture, and thrives in both sun and partial shade. In plantings, it is valued for its ability to quickly close the canopy and suppress weeds, while not suffering from diseases or pests. Its dense clumps of fresh green leaves form a perfect undergrowth under taller shrubs or trees and bring dynamics to the beds even when other summer perennials are already fading. The 'Lisan' cultivar stands out for its striking, crimson-red inflorescences in the shape of narrow spikes, which tower above the leaves from July until the first frosts in October. Compared to some other persicarias, it grows to a more compact height of between 50 and 75 centimeters and does not require support, as its stems are firm and upright. These candle-like flowers look very impressive in perennial plantings and are literally a magnet for bees and other pollinators. Persicaria 'Lisan' is also excellent for cutting into a vase, where its rich color and interesting structure will last for several days and perfectly complement autumn arrangements.
